Why Timing Matters on Naver Blog for User Engagement, Naver Search, and Search Rankings 

Why Timing Matters on Naver Blog for User Engagement, Naver Search, and Search Rankings

Unlike Western platforms like Google or Medium, NAVER Blog is tightly integrated with search visibility and user-generated content discovery. Because blog posts are indexed quickly on NAVER and often featured in real-time search rankings, publishing during peak activity windows increases your chances of being noticed, engaged, and shared. Moreover, NAVER users are highly mobile, so timing must align with commute hours, lunch breaks, and evening wind-downs. A od post at the wrong time could go unnoticed.

Ideal Days for Publishing Naver Blog Content

  1. Tuesday through Thursday: These weekdays emerge as the prime periods for engagement. Mondayften witnesses a sluggish start as individuals recalibrate after the weekend, while Friday experiences a gradual decline as weekend preparations commence. Theidweek period is particularly conducive for targeting professional readers and users engaged in “search mode,” seeking specific information.
  2. Saturday (Morning Specific): While weekend blog readership may generally dip, Saturday mornings, specifically between 9 AM and 11 AM, still present a noteworthy engagement window. This period particularly favors lifestyle, parenting, and beauty-related content. Korean users are more likely to have leisure time and engage in casual browsing during this time.
  3. Discouraged Periods: Sunday and Monday: Sunday evenings and Monday mornings typically exhibit diminished interaction rates. rs are either winding down the weekend or initiating the workweek and are less inclined to bractively owse or participate in blog discussions actively.

Optimal Times to Post Naver Blog Content Throughout the Day

Optimal Times to Post Naver Blog Content Throughout the Day
  1. Early Morning Window (6 AM to 8 AM): This period captures the attention of Korean users who promptly check their mobile devices upon waking, particularly during their commute. rt-form, visually rich content like beauty tips, motivational posts, or concise product showcases thrives in this window.
  2. Lunchtime Window (11:30 AM to 1:30 PM): Many individuals turn to their mobile devices for entertainment and information during the traditional Korean lunch hour around noon. s presents a highly advantageous opportunity for blog visibility, particularly for food critiques, trending topics, and news articles.
  3. Evening Prime Time (7 PM to 10 PM): This constitutes the prime window for blog readership. Following inner and household responsibilities, Naver users often engage in leisurely browsing. Lifestyle narratives, parenting guidance, technology reviews, and in-depth, long-form articles excel during this period.
  4. Avoid Posting Between 2 AM and 6 AM: While Naver’s indexing remains operational around the clock, engagement levels plummet to near zero during these wee hours, unless your content caters to a specific niche audience, such as night shift workers or dedicated gamers.

Mobile vs. Desktop User Behavior

Mobile devices form the primary avenue for accessing Naver blog content, particularly during transit and short breaks. etheless, desktop views remain significant, notably during work hours and for in-depth material.

  • Mobile-Centric Peak Times:
    • Morning Commutes (6 AM to 9 AM)
    • Lunchtime (11:30 AM to 1:30 PM)
    • Evening Leisure (7 PM to 10 PM)
  • Desktop-Preferred Windows:
    • Office Hours (9 AM to 11 AM)
    • Mid-Afternoon (2 PM to 4 PM)

The Influence of Seasonality and Cultural Context

  1. Holidays and Significant National Celebrations: Publishing during pivotal Korean holidays like Seollal or Chuseok can substantially elevate visibility if the content aligns with the occasion (e.g., gift guides, holiday-themed beauty tips). ever, avoid overt promotions during days predominantly reserved for family time.
  2. Back-to-School and Exam Periods: These periods are conducive to disseminating educational resources, productivity advice, and parenting content.
  3. Korean Consumer Events: Synchronize your blog content posting schedule with major retail campaigns, such as Korean Black Friday (Korea Sale Festa) or brand-specific anniversaries, to capitalize on increased consumer activity on Naver Shopping.

Match Post Timing with Content Type

Understanding the nuanced relationship between content type and ideal naver blog posting times for engagement can significantly enhance user experience. Orn-depth content s,uch as product reviews or comprehensive service guides, scheduling for the evening hours proves more effective. ing these times, readers are generally more relaxed and have the leisure to delve into detailed information. the other hand, quick tips, daily inspirations, or brief announcements capture readers’ attention best during the morning, seeking concise, motivating content. aligning your posting schedule with the typical reader’s mindset and daily routine, you can optimize the impact of your valuable content, leading to better readership and interaction rates.

Content TypeIdeal Posting TimeReasoning
In-Depth Reviews/GuidesEvening (7 PM-10 PM)Readers are relaxed and have more time for detailed information.
Quick Tips/InspirationsMorning (6 AM-8 AM)Captures the attention of users checking devices, seeking concise content before the day begins.
Daily AnnouncementsMorning (6 AM-8 AM)Best when users seek brief updates before starting work/activities.
Food Critiques/News CommentaryLunchtime (11:30 AM-1:30 PM)Users often browse for entertainment/info during breaks; aligns with meal times.
Lifestyle NarrativesEvening (7 PM-10 PM)Preferred when users wind down and engage in leisurely browsing.
Product Showcases (Short-Form)Morning (6 AM-8 AM)Visually rich, concise showcases are ideal for users quickly checking for updates.
Educational ResourcesBack-to-School/Exam PeriodsTiming aligns with students’ needs and parental involvement during these specific times.
Gift Guides (Holidays)Pivotal Korean HolidaysContent is relevant and appeals to shopping needs during these times.
Productivity AdviceBack-to-School/Exam PeriodsUsers are more receptive to productivity tools and tips during these periods.
Technology ReviewsEvening (7 PM-10 PM)Often require an in-depth understanding; users have more time for technical details in the evening.

How is Naver blog SEO different from Google SEO?

Naver favors its platforms like Naver Blog more than Google favors its own. While both care about good content, link building is less critical for Naver. Unlike Google, Naver focuses on creating great content that people want to share, which helps you get organic links. Understanding what Korean users are looking for is key.

What else helps a Naver blog succeed beyond posting times?

Besides good timing, do keyword research to find what users search for. Create content that answers those searches. Encourage comments and shares. Keep up with Naver’s algorithm changes and connect with other Naver services like Naver Maps. Working with Naver blog influencers can also boost visibility.
